Understanding Gate Mechanisms
Gates can be manual or automatic, and each type has its own set of components. Understanding these mechanisms can help you identify potential issues.
Manual Gates
Manual gates are operated by hand. They typically consist of hinges, latches, and locks. Common problems with manual gates include:
Rusty Hinges: Over time, hinges can rust, making it difficult to open and close the gate smoothly.
Misaligned Latches: If the latch is not aligned properly, it can prevent the gate from closing securely.
Worn Out Locks: Locks can wear out, making it hard to secure the gate.
Automatic Gates
Automatic gates are powered by electricity and often include motors, sensors, and remote controls. Common issues with automatic gates include:
Motor Malfunctions: The motor may fail, causing the gate to stop working.
Sensor Issues: If the sensors are blocked or malfunctioning, the gate may not open or close properly.
Remote Control Problems: Sometimes, the remote control may not work due to dead batteries or signal interference.
Signs Your Gate Needs Repair
Recognizing the signs that your gate needs repair is essential for maintaining its functionality. Here are some indicators to watch for:
Unusual Noises: If you hear grinding, squeaking, or clunking sounds when operating the gate, it may indicate a problem.
Difficulty Opening or Closing: If the gate is hard to move, it may need lubrication or repairs.
Visible Damage: Look for cracks, rust, or other visible damage that could affect the gate's operation.
Inconsistent Operation: If the gate opens or closes erratically, it may require professional attention.

Maintenance Tips for Smooth Gate Operation
Preventative maintenance can help keep your gate in good condition. Here are some tips:
Regular Lubrication: Lubricate hinges and moving parts regularly to prevent rust and ensure smooth operation.
Inspect for Damage: Regularly check for visible damage and address any issues promptly.
Clean Sensors: For automatic gates, keep sensors clean and free from obstructions.
Test Functionality: Periodically test the gate to ensure it opens and closes smoothly.

When to Replace Your Gate
Sometimes, repairs may not be enough. Here are signs that it may be time to replace your gate:
Severe Damage: If the gate is severely damaged or rusted, replacement may be more cost-effective.
Frequent Repairs: If you find yourself constantly repairing the gate, it may be time for a new one.
Outdated Technology: For automatic gates, outdated technology may not be worth repairing.
